David Burdine (an ex F-14 instructor) now flies his beautiful blue and red MIG-17 at airshows across the midwest. This is his demonstration from the Southern Wisconsin Airfest 2006 in Janesville WI. Davids bird is an Polish licensed built aircraft made in 1960 and served in the Polish Airforce untill being withdrawn from service in 1990 (wow 30 years). The MIG-17 was one of the first aircraft to be equiped with an afterburner, which by todays standards looks quite a bit different than burners most of are used to seeing.
